Summary

CVE-2023-41919 is a critical-severity Use of Hard-coded Credentials (CWE-798) vulnerability in Kiloview P2 Firmware. Its CVSS base score is 9.8 (Critical).

Operationally, ranked at the 34.1th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

EU & UK References

Vulnerability details

Hardcoded credentials are discovered within the application's source code, creating a potential security risk for unauthorized access.
